A new family of diamagnetic macrocyclic Fe(ii) compounds exhibiting the LIESST effect at high temperatures

Abstract

The photomagnetic properties of a new Fe(II) macrocyclic family [Fe(LxyzN5)(CN)2nH2O were investigated with respect to the T(LIESST) versus T1/2 relationship. These compounds are diamagnetic below 400 K with T(LIESST) values above 100 K, which indicates that this family presents an unconventional LIESST effect that is much higher than the expected T0 = 180 K line for macrocyclic complexes.
